Flight36 exists to provide fatherless boys with godly male role models whom they can grow with in healthy, affirming relationships while flying higher spiritually on their journey with God.

Although having fathers reengage in their homes is the best scenario for healthy development, this is not always an option. Most single moms would agree the next best thing would be godly men who have a heart to simply inspire their sons, encouraging them to grow in their masculinity and spirituality as God intended.

Fatherless homes account for:

* 90% of all homeless and runaway children
* 85% of all children that exhibit behavioral disorders
* 75% of all adolescent patients in chemical abuse centers
* 70% of juveniles in state-operated detention centers
* 70% of all high school dropouts
* 65% of youth suicides
* 60% Poor grades or grades substantially below ability
* 63% Subjective psychological problem (defined as anxiety, moodiness, phobias, and depression)

While these staggering statistics are heartbreaking in the least, we at Flight36 believe they can be all together avoided through the proper channels.

While we will not, in anyway, replace missing fathers, we will engage in the activities that fathers and sons have enjoyed through the ages. We will build model rockets, attend baseball games, play sports and go biking together, just to name a few of those activities.

The boys will also learn to give back to God in love and gratitude through regular service projects and raising support for ministries within their home church. We will serve alongside other ministries to bless single moms, orphans and the elderly in our community.

Flight36 would not be complete without the discipleship aspect of the program. During the time enrolled in our program, the boys will go through a biblical training program. We will focus on foundational topics such as God’s love, being good stewards, forgiveness and understanding our purpose in life.

Our prayer is that the young boys we minister to will learn to love and trust their true Father who will “never leave them nor forsake them” through developing caring and encouraging relationships with men who honor and revere their Father, God.

The purpose of Flight36 seemed apparent when we discovered a pattern established in the lives of men that grew up in a father-absent home. We have outlined this pattern below. Though we cannot prove this to be true in all men, the men we discussed this cycle with found similar patterns in their own lives.

We believe God is using Flight36 to minimize the potential destruction of the cycle in the boys who participate in our program. By creating healthy, affirming relationships while relating life situation to Biblical principles, we can make a difference. The cycle contains four parts as shown in the diagram below. Each part playing a role of the next effected behavior.

If God is not the center of their lives, they will find someone or something to center their lives on which will ultimately lead to a chaotic and destructive lifestyle. These negative choices affect themselves and those around them.

Feeling of Abandonment
The result of the feeling of abandonment is the inability to feel love from others. People have tendency not to trust and build walls for protection.

Fear of Intimacy
The result of the fear of intimacy is the inability to develop authentic relationships. People have a tendency to be skeptical of others love or affection.

Sense of Independence
The result of having a sense of independence is the total reliance upon one’s own abilities to accomplish and complete tasks and meet goals. People have a tendency to feel alone and develop false expectations for those around them.

Lack of Positive Affirmation
People who lack affirmation from a positive source will eventually find it in other areas, usually unfulfilling and sometimes dangerous.

Our mission is to combat the cycle that could potentially build up in the boys we serve before it is to late.

We will accomplish this mission by surrounding each boy with a fleet of men who will listen, support and encourage them as they learn about themselves and the plan God has marked out for them. The best way for Flight36 to impact the lives of these young boys is to spend as much quality time with them as possible.

We provide the boys in our program with over 40 opportunities (100+ hours) for mentoring and participation in the recreation events, group meetings, Bible studies and community service projects hosted by the Flight36 staff and our sponsors.

Specifically, the boys in our program may participate in the following:

- Recreation Events (Baseball games, biking, bowling, flag football, fishing, etc.)
- Small Group Bible Studies (Life application, round-table discussions and character development)
- Community Outreach and Service Projects
- Fundraising Events (Funds to benefit other ministries and organizations)
- Summer Camps and Workshops
- Family Day Retreats

Boys in our program receive the following:

- Enrollment into our three-year leadership academy
- Boys Flight Manual containing all study materials and resources required for our program
- 36 Round-Table Discussion Outlines for the mother/son weekly devotionals
- 36 Scripture Memorization Cards
- Boys Study Bible, Daily Devotions Book and Journal
- Flight36 logoed t-shirt for community outreach and service projects
- Flight36 logoed polo dress shirt for special occasions
- Military dog tags displaying name, rank, local chapter and emergency telephone numbers

By doing so, we can eliminate the feeling of abandonment. We can show them how to build healthy relationships and discuss how God has made each of us to love and work in community with one another. And finally, the men of Flight36 provide encouragement, positive affirmation and a witness as to where they can find their true significance and security in life. We can point to God, their true father who will never leave them nor forsake them.
